David Brewster is a Boston-based angel investor and climate tech entrepreneur with 25 years of experience building mission-driven energy companies, notably co-founding and scaling EnerNOC to $500M in revenue before its 2017 sale to Enel Group[1][6]. His investment thesis centers on clean technology, big data analytics, and smart buildings, targeting pre-seed and seed stages[1][2]. While specific check sizes are not publicly detailed, he participated in LineVision’s $2M Series A round and has backed ReferralMob and LineVision as an individual investor[1]. His notable portfolio includes LineVision, a grid optimization firm, ReferralMob, and Leap, a Business/Productivity Software company in which he invested in November 2023[1][4]. Brewster distinguishes himself through active board roles at Vicinity Energy, Cortex Sustainability Intelligence, and PearlX Infrastructure, alongside advisory work for LineVision, Antin Infrastructure Partners, and the World Resources Institute[1][5].
